1. Does the Platform Offer Scalability and Customization?
As your business or educational program grows, your Course Building Platform should scale with you. A rigid platform can quickly become a bottleneck, limiting your ability to expand course offerings, accommodate a growing learner base, or integrate new technologies. To ensure long-term success, evaluate the following:
Customization Options
The ability to tailor branding, themes, course layouts, and user interfaces ensures your platform aligns with your brand identity and learning goals. Look for platforms that allow advanced customization, such as white-labeling, custom domain usage, and personalized dashboards for learners.
Scalability
A good platform should handle an increasing number of learners and courses without compromising performance. Check if the platform offers cloud-based infrastructure, load balancing, and automatic scaling to support growth.
Integration Capabilities
Seamless integration with Learning Management Systems (LMSs), Customer Relationship Management (CRM) software, and marketing automation tools can streamline operations. Platforms that support API access and integrations with tools like Zapier, HubSpot, and Salesforce offer added flexibility.
Multi-Tenancy Support
If you plan to offer courses to different groups, such as corporate clients, educational institutions, or internal teams, multi-tenancy support allows you to manage multiple learning environments under one system.
Mobile and Multi-Device Accessibility
With an increasing number of learners accessing content on mobile devices, a scalable platform should provide a responsive design and dedicated mobile applications.
A scalable platform allows for continuous growth without switching systems, which can be costly and disruptive. Future-proofing your investment ensures that your platform remains relevant and efficient as your needs evolve.

2. What Learning Formats and Engagement Tools Are Available?
Different learners engage with content in various ways, making diverse learning formats essential. The effectiveness of a Course Building Platform depends on how well it supports different learning styles. Look for a platform that includes:
Multimedia Content
The ability to incorporate video, audio, interactive quizzes, and infographics is crucial for engagement. Studies show that video-based learning increases retention rates by 25-60% compared to text-based content (Forrester Research).
Gamification Features
Incorporating elements such as badges, point systems, and leaderboards can significantly boost learner motivation and drive interaction. According to a recent report, such gamified strategies have the potential to elevate learner engagement by as much as 50%.
Community Engagement
Built-in discussion forums, live Q&As, and peer collaboration features create a sense of community and encourage knowledge sharing.
AI-Powered Adaptive Learning
AI-driven platforms personalize course content based on individual learner progress, improving retention and learning outcomes.
Live Learning & Webinars
The ability to conduct live classes or one-on-one sessions via Zoom or Microsoft Teams integration adds flexibility and real-time interaction.
Engagement tools enhance the learning experience, ensuring students stay motivated and complete their courses successfully.

3. Does It Offer Robust Analytics and Reporting?
Data-driven insights are key to improving course effectiveness and learner outcomes. A well-designed Course Building Platform should provide:
Learner Progress Tracking
Monitor course completion rates, quiz scores, and time spent on modules to identify engagement patterns and areas for improvement. Detailed tracking helps instructors intervene early if learners struggle.
Performance Metrics
Analyze learner performance through assessment scores, feedback surveys, and participation rates to refine content. Performance analytics highlight strengths and weaknesses, enabling content adjustments for better comprehension.
Custom Reports
Generate in-depth insights based on learner behavior, engagement, and assessment results, enabling data-driven decision-making. Customizable dashboards allow educators to focus on key performance indicators (KPIs) specific to their goals.
AI-Based Recommendations
Some platforms use AI to suggest content improvements and personalized learning paths based on user data, improving retention and engagement. Heatmaps and Engagement Analytics
Track which parts of a course are most engaging and where learners tend to drop off, helping instructors optimize course flow. Heatmaps visually highlight areas of high and low interaction within a course module.
Predictive Analytics
Advanced platforms leverage predictive analytics to foresee learner challenges, recommend intervention strategies, and enhance user experience. Predictive insights help educators proactively address learning gaps and provide targeted support.
Having access to comprehensive analytics enables course creators to refine their offerings and maximize learner success.

5. How Secure and Reliable Is the Platform?
Data security and reliability should be top priorities when selecting an upskilling platform for tech professionals and programmers. A secure platform ensures:
Data Encryption & Compliance
Adherence to global security standards, including GDPR, SOC 2, and ISO 27001, ensuring data privacy and regulatory compliance.
Regular Backups & Recovery
Automated backups conducted frequently reduce the risk of data loss and ensure business continuity for IT organizations.
99.9% Uptime Guarantee
A cloud-based infrastructure ensures minimal downtime, providing uninterrupted access to training programs.
Role-Based Access & MFA
To protect sensitive data and prevent unauthorized access, platforms implement multi-factor authentication (MFA) and role-based access controls.
Fraud Protection & Secure Payments
Advanced fraud detection mechanisms and encrypted payment processing prevent unauthorized transactions, ensuring financial security.
DDoS & Cyber Threat Protection
Integration of intrusion detection systems, advanced firewalls, and real-time threat monitoring safeguards against cyberattacks and unauthorized access.
